How Aging Populations Influence Economic Growth

August 1, 2026

There’s no escaping the trend: the United States is aging.

America’s median age hit a new high of 39.4 in 2025, according to population estimates from the U.S. Census Bureau, up from 35.6 in 2001. Nearly one in three Americans is over 55, compared with about one in four in 2010.

At first glance it might seem that longer lifespans are driving this shift; however, data show that this is the smaller of two main forces. Life expectancy rose from 78.1 in 2007 to 79.0 in 2024, a gain of just over 1 percent, while the general fertility rate—the number of births per 1,000 women aged 15–44—dropped by 22 percent over the same span. So even though people live a bit longer, American women have been giving birth at the lowest rate of any cohort since the late 1970s, and demographic patterns are responding accordingly.

An aging population brings with it unavoidable questions about future economic growth, especially as the labor force shrinks and firms seek ways to sustain output with fewer workers. In addition, the entire baby-boom generation is nearing the standard retirement age of 67, which will intensify pressure on entitlement programs like Social Security and Medicare.

That prognosis may look grim, but there are reasons for optimism as well. Even as conventional thinking links aging populations to slower growth, fresh research is revealing surprising ways economies adapt to demographic change.

The trade-offs of aging.

Scholarly work has long suggested that an aging population can drag on a country’s per-capita GDP—the total output divided by the number of people. A recent study covering 1980–2010 found that for every 10 percentage-point rise in the share of people over 60, U.S. per-capita GDP fell by 5.5 percent, driven by slower employment growth and weaker productivity. The authors concluded that aging reduced the growth rate of the United States’ per-capita GDP by about 0.3 percentage points during that period.

A common way to frame this is via the “support ratio.” This metric compares a country’s working-age population (for example, those aged 20–64) to its total population. A higher support ratio signals more earners supporting fewer dependents, such as children and retirees; a lower ratio means the economy has a harder time sustaining non-working segments. As the United States trends toward a lower support ratio, the net effect is expected to be a drag on growth metrics.

“I think it’s clear, even without invoking AI, that slower population growth tends to translate into slower GDP growth almost in a one-to-one fashion,” Ronald Lee, professor emeritus of economics and demography at the University of California, Berkeley, told The Dispatch. Yet Lee noted that while GDP growth drives much of the aging-economy conversation, more precise measures of living standards—such as per-capita income—tell a different story, where the impact is not at all straightforward.

Economists, including Lee, have argued that slower growth in the labor force could boost the amount of capital available per worker, potentially lifting productivity and wages. Lee has also argued that a lower birth rate can increase the capital invested per child, partially offsetting the economic effects of fewer workers.

But above all, perhaps the most hopeful factor is that technological innovation could neutralize many of the downsides of an aging population.

Can technology fill the gaps?

A new working paper published by the National Bureau of Economic Research this month analyzes seven decades of demographic change across dozens of countries. The authors find that, contrary to common assumptions, lower birth rates have increased GDP per working-age adult enough to fully offset the negative implications of a shrinking population, leaving aggregate GDP broadly unchanged.

Keelan Beirne, an MIT Ph.D. candidate and one of the paper’s co-authors, told The Dispatch that the results surprised the team but that the evidence is robust across nations and across various regions of the United States. “Across the board, we found that these lower birth rates led to faster adoption and progress in technology,” Beirne said. In short, when countries confronted a thinner workforce, they leaned more into tech-driven solutions and enjoyed higher productivity as a result.

Fresh findings from Harvard Business School professor Joseph Fuller also point to technology as a crucial factor in offsetting aging. Fuller suggested that artificial intelligence could help older Americans stay in the workforce longer if firms invest in midcareer retraining and permit seasoned workers to take on roles emphasizing judgment. “We must stop assuming older workers can’t adapt to new technology and begin viewing them as reservoirs of knowledge and perspective essential to unlocking technology’s potential,” Fuller said in a Harvard Business School interview.

Yet, even with the upside tech offers, innovation cannot solve every economic issue created by aging—most notably the mounting pressure on Social Security from its growing pool of beneficiaries. “While this has been the pattern in the past, and perhaps the way the economy works, aging may unfold differently in the future for a variety of reasons,” Beirne said about the limits of technology’s mitigating role. “One reason is certainly the government’s fiscal position.”

The future of pension programs.

The bright side for the United States is that, when compared with many Western peers, America’s elderly population relies far less on public transfers like Social Security, welfare, and pensions. In countries such as Belgium, France, and Finland, individuals over 65 derive more than 70 percent of their retirement income from public sources, whereas Americans in the same age bracket draw less than 40 percent from government funds. The United States has higher labor force participation among seniors and a sizable share of retirement income comes from private pension plans like 401(k)s. And although America’s birth rate is shrinking, it remains higher than the majority of European nations.

The bad news is that this might not be enough to avert Social Security’s looming financial crisis, which could shave about $16,900 off annual benefits per retiree, according to a recent report by the Committee for a Responsible Federal Budget. The Social Security trustees’ annual report projects insolvency in 2032 if current trajectories persist. “We have to do something,” Lee said. “That’s obvious. It’s been obvious for decades, but now the urgency is growing.”

The trustees’ report estimates the actuarial deficit for Social Security over the next 75 years at 4.42 percent of taxable payroll, or about 1.5 percent of GDP. Yet Lee argued that such revenue could be better used for children and proposed raising the retirement age for those with high lifetime earnings. He also suggested automatic stabilizers to ensure the benefit structure adapts reliably to demographic and economic shifts, pointing to Sweden and Germany as examples of automatic stabilization in pension systems.

“I think it’s crucial that we accept that people are living longer,” Lee said. “They’re healthier for longer, they retain cognitive strength longer, and they should be able—indeed, they should be encouraged—to work longer as well.”
